QA Automation Engineer
TypeScript, Cypress, CI/CD
Rzeszów, Białystok, Łódź, Remotely
Job description
The successful QA Automation Engineer will be working closely alongside extremely talented and driven engineers to build and support eCommerce / Marketplaces business.
Responsibilities
- Writing E2E tests in Cypress using TypeScript basing on documentation provided by Manual QAs
- Participating in daily releases process (reporting failures to Manual QAs)
- Tests execution time optimization
- Looking for process improvements, new tools
- Defining Monthly Goals for QA/E2E department
Requirements
- Work experience as a QA Automation Engineer
- Good Cypress.io knowledge (Cypress + TypeScript)
- Experience in JIRA, mailtrap (or other email catcher)
- Understanding and experience with Page Object Pattern
- Experience in optimisation of tests execution time
- Understanding of CI/CD processes and tools
- Skill in analysis, solid decision-making and problem-solving
- Knowledge of the basic principles, processes, phases and roles of application development methodologies
- Fluent english
- Good communication skills (cross culture team)
Nice to have
- Experience in Visual Tests
- Experience in working with React and Angular applications
- Experience in JMeter / other stress / load testing tools
- Strong experience in API tests (Postman)
- Experience in configuration Cypress tests with Browserstack
- Experience in Test Data generation
- Experience in working with Segment
- Experience in working mentoring less experienced team members
Our Perks & Benefits
- Attractive salary
- Flexible working hours
- Opportunity for development
- Work in an international team
- English lessons
- Budget for self-development
- Benefits package: team building trips, fruit Tuesdays, sweet Thursdays, access to medical care and sports card
- Remote work or work in one of our offices in: Rzeszów, Białystok or Łódź